How to Prevent Dark Spots Caused by UV Rays

Introduction

Dark spots are one of the most common skin concerns caused by prolonged exposure to sunlight. Many people notice uneven skin tone, pigmentation, and dullness after spending time outdoors without proper protection.

Ultraviolet (UV) rays from the sun can trigger increased melanin production, which is the natural pigment responsible for skin color. When melanin production becomes uneven, dark patches and spots may appear on different areas of the skin.

What Causes Dark Spots From UV Rays?

1. Excessive Sun Exposure

The most common cause of sun-related dark spots is repeated exposure to UV rays. When skin detects sun damage, it increases melanin production as a natural defense mechanism.

Over time, this process may contribute to:

  • Uneven skin tone
  • Sun spots
  • Dark patches
  • Dull-looking complexion

Reducing direct sun exposure and using protective skincare habits can help minimize the visible effects of UV damage.

How Do UV Rays Create Dark Spots?

UV rays can influence the skin’s pigment-producing cells. When these cells become overactive due to repeated sun exposure, they may produce excess melanin in certain areas.

This can result in visible pigmentation, especially on areas that receive more sunlight, such as:

  • Face
  • Forehead
  • Cheeks
  • Nose
  • Hands

Protecting these areas consistently can help support a more even-looking complexion.

Effective Ways to Prevent Dark Spots

1. Apply Sun Protection Every Day

Daily sun protection is one of the most important steps for preventing UV-related pigmentation. Sunscreen creates a protective barrier that helps reduce direct exposure to harmful UV rays.

For better protection:

  • Apply sunscreen before going outdoors
  • Use enough product for proper coverage
  • Reapply when spending extended time in sunlight
  • Do not skip sunscreen during cloudy weather

4. Limit Direct Sun Exposure

While sunscreen is important, reducing unnecessary sun exposure can provide additional support.

Helpful habits include:

  • Wearing sunglasses
  • Using hats or protective clothing
  • Staying in shade when possible
  • Avoiding direct sunlight during peak hours

These simple steps can reduce daily UV stress on the skin.

Common Mistakes That Make Dark Spots Worse

Not Reapplying Sunscreen

One application may not always provide all-day protection, especially during outdoor activities. Reapplication helps maintain sun protection.

Using Harsh Skincare Products

Strong or irritating products may weaken the skin barrier and increase sensitivity. Gentle formulas are usually more suitable for daily care.

Ignoring Early Signs of Pigmentation

Addressing changes in skin tone early with proper protection and skincare habits can help maintain a more balanced appearance.

Following an Inconsistent Routine

Skincare results require patience and regular care. Frequently changing products or skipping steps can reduce effectiveness.
